ELEMENTARY SCHOOL LANGUAGE ARTS LESSON PLAN WEB RESOURCES
Web English Teacher http://www.webenglishteacher.com
This site allows teachers to share resources and learn from each other. It includes Elementary School Language Arts lesson plans, activities, and resources for all areas in the English discipline ranging from poetry to Shakespeare to yearbook publishing.
Rank: 3
AskERIC Language Arts Page http://askeric.org/cgi-bin/lessons.cgi/Language_Arts
A site with Elementary School Language Arts lesson plans and activities in areas such as grammar, speech, listening comprehension, and MANY others.
Rank: 3
A.J. Jordak Library Media Center http://www.cardinal.k12.oh.us/jordak/jlib/sts_LA.htm
A "grab bag" website that has many interesting Language Arts activities for all ages of children. These activities touch on improving knowledge in grammar, writing, reading, and spelling.
Rank: 3
Dositey.com http://www.dositey.com/langk2.htm
Dositey contains printable worksheets for students in areas ranging from spelling to phonics. This site is geared towards grades K-2.
Rank: 2
Cooperative Activities - Language Arts Activities http://www.coedu.usf.edu/~morris/lanart.html
This site has 15 great exercises that should be used for grades 4-6. It offers different ways to turn various language art skills into interesting and affective activities.
Rank: 2
Education Planet Linguistics and Language Arts Page http://www.educationplanet.com/search/Linguistics_and_Language_Arts
This website has everything from links, information on many language arts subcategories, education news, and featured software. This site does not have a lot of specific Elementary Language Arts lesson plans or activities, but the content covers a broad range of Language Arts topics and is sure to help get the creative juices flowing.
Rank: 2
Language Arts Primary Games http://www.primarygames.com/reading.htm
A site with games for students to play on the internet to teach language arts. Need internet access to play. Rank: 1
